Kapitel 11: Listener

Inzwischen hast du schon viele verschiedene Möglichkeiten kennengelernt, die Spielwelt zu beeinflussen und zu verändern. Auslöser war dafür bisher immer die Eingabe eines Befehls durch den Spieler. Du wirst in diesem Kapitel aber sehen, dass es auch möglich ist, dein Plugin so zu programmieren, dass es auf Veränderungen in der Welt reagiert, zum Beispiel, wenn ein bestimmter Block zerstört wird oder ein Spieler ein bestimmtes Areal betritt. Solche Plugins werden auch als Listener bezeichnet, was Englisch für »Zuhörer« ist, da sie ständig in die Spielwelt »hineinhören«, um Veränderungen zu entdecken.

11.1  Grundgerüst

Mit der onCommand-Funktion haben alle Plugins, die auf Chat-Befehle reagieren, ein gemeinsames ...

Get Let's Play Minecraft: Plugins programmieren mit Python now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.